The forecasted import of peaches and nectarines to Italy shows a consistent upward trend from 2024 to 2028. The volume is expected to increase annually, beginning at 140.22 million kilograms in 2024 and rising steadily to 153.98 million kilograms by 2028. This steady growth reflects a year-on-year percentage increase that averages approximately 2.5% over the period.
In assessing longer-term trends, the cumulative average growth rate (CAGR) over the five-year period from 2024 to 2028 suggests a sustained growth trajectory for Italy's peach and nectarine imports.
Future trends to watch for include potential impacts of climate change on crop yields, shifts in consumer preferences towards fresh fruits, and import policy changes within the European Union that could affect supply chain dynamics. Additionally, ongoing economic fluctuations could influence both the demand and pricing structures for these fruits.
